Electronic Positioner CU01
Inductive position transmitter IWG 1003
IWG 1003 is similar to IWG 1002 however with
3 wire system.
IWG 1003
CU 01
The electronic positioner CU01 is designed as a
three level positioner for regulating of actuator.
By comparing two input signals (reference
signal W & regulating signal X), the positioner
determines the difference. In case this exceeds a
certain value, the actuator is switched on by
relays. The direction of rotation (opening or
19
closing) depends upon the plus or minus sign of
the deviation. Thus the regulating signal
generated by potentiometer or LVDT changes &
when the regulating signal & reference signal
become equal, the actuator stops as long as no
new correction is required.
